Why Does Your Back Hurt During Weddings?
Whether it’s the day-long haldi and mehendi ceremonies, long pheras, or baraat dancing, you’re mostly on your feet. Standing for hours puts a lot of pressure on your lower back. All this comes with a price – back pain. And don’t forget about the dancing. From naagin dance to breakdancing, our backs go through a full workout at weddings. And it all comes crashing down the next morning when you’re unable to move a muscle without wincing in pain.

1. Start with the Right Posture
Your mom was right – stand up straight! Posture plays a huge role in managing back pain during weddings. Here’s how you can improve it:
- Keep your shoulders relaxed
- Distribute weight evenly on both feet
- Avoid standing still by shifting weight or taking mini walks
- Sit with back support whenever possible
2. Choose Comfort with Style
Okay, you want to look like a Bollywood star. We get it. But sometimes, a few tweaks can save your back without compromising your style.
- Avoid super high heels for long durations.
- Pick lighter fabrics or layered outfits to reduce strain.
- Try posture-friendly shapewear that supports your lower back.

4. Squeeze in Quick Stretches
Even 30 seconds can make a huge difference. Try to stretch every once in a while, to prevent stiffness and reduce the chance of post-party pain. A simple neck roll, shoulder roll or a side bend would do.
5. Try Home Remedies For Body Pain
You don’t always need run to a chemist store to get relief. Some of the best fixes are already in your kitchen or bathroom. These home remedies for body pain are simple, natural, and oh-so-effective.
· Warm Compress: Place a warm towel or heating pad on your back to relax muscles. It works great after a long event.
· Turmeric Milk: Good ol’ haldi doodh has anti-inflammatory benefits. Sip it before bed to help your body recover.
6. Hydrate & Eat Right
You may not realize this, but dehydration and poor nutrition can worsen back pain. So remember to drink enough water throughout the event. Try to avoid excessive caffeine or sugary drinks and don’t skip meals because your body needs fuel.
Don’t Ignore the Pain
Here’s something important: occasional back pain is common, but constant pain isn't. If you're experiencing:
- Continuous pain lasting for days
- Pain radiating to your legs
- Numbness or tingling
- Difficulty walking or standing
Please consult a doctor. Wedding season is temporary, but your health is long-term.
